Can Item Category group be configured per sales org distribution channel

Former Member
0 Kudos

Hi,

We use SAP IS-Retail. The item category group NORM is defaulted for the article type FERT which automatically shows up on the Basic data view and also on the sales view for a sales org/dist channel. When I wipe out the Item category group from the Basic Data view and save the article it still remains as NORM in the sales view. What I'd like to know is anywhere in the config can Item category group be defaulted per sales org/dist channel.

Try this. Define a custom item catg grp for eg ZNORM. Anyway item catg grp is maintained in Sales org 2 view. So for your particular sales org for eg 1000view in MM02 maintain the custom item catg grp ZNORM. Like mentioned earlier, maintain the default material type - item catg grp assignement in SPRO.

In MM02--> Sales org 2, in field Item catg grp maintain ZNORM. In general item catg grp maintain NORM.

During item catg determination system will pickup the ietm catg grp maintained in MM02 --> item catg grp.

In VOV4 maintain the below setting: OR / ZNORM --> ZTAN. So when you raise a sales order in 1000 sales org, item catg ZTAN will be proposed.

Chec if it works.

Item catg grp is not based on a sales org / dist channel. In item catg determination, system will pickup the item catg grp maintained in Sales org 2.

Pls do note that Item catg determination is based on Sales order type / item catg grp (from material master) / usage.

So no where item catg grp or item catg is dependent on sales org.

Reason being a NORM can be a material type FERT, HAWA, HALB etc. You will maintain that assignment in SPRO --> SD --> Sales --> Define default material types.
